U.S. patent number D330,602 [Application Number 07/652,744] was granted by the patent office on 1992-10-27 for chemiluminescent signal for attachment to the arm. This patent grant is currently assigned to American Cyanamid Company. Invention is credited to William E. Bay, John J. Freeman, Jr., Robert D. Giglia.
